Apr 27


*=========================================================

Percabangan if dengan 1 kondisi

*===========================================================

#include <iostream.h>
int main()
{
int bilangan;
char huruf;
//memasukkan bilangan bulat
cout<<”Masukkan sebuah bilangan bulat: “;
cin>>bilangan;
if ((bilangan > 0) && (bilangan < 10))
cout<<bilangan<<” lebih besar dari nol dan lebih kecil dari sepuluh”;
//memasukkan huruf
cout<<“\n“;
cout<<”Masukkan sebuah huruf: “;
cin>>huruf;
if ((huruf == ‘A’) || (huruf == ‘a’) || (huruf == ‘I’) ||
(huruf == ‘i’) || (huruf == ‘U’) || (huruf == ‘u’) ||
(huruf == ‘E’) || (huruf == ‘e’) || (huruf == ‘O’) ||
(huruf == ‘o’))
{
cout<<huruf<<” adalah huruf vokal”;
}
return 0;
}

*============================================================

Percabangan dengan 2 kondisi “if-else”

*============================================================

#include <iostream.h>
int main()
{
int nilai;
//memasukkan bilangan bulat
cout<<”Masukkan sebuah bilangan bulat: “;

cin>>nilai;
//pengecek bilangan apakah habis dibagi dua atau tidak
if (nilai %2 == 0)
{
cout<<nilai<<“adalah bilangan genap“;
}
else
{
cout<<nilai<<“adalah bilangan ganjil“;
}
return 0;
}

*=============================================================

Percabangan dengan 3 kondisi “multiple else”

*=============================================================

#include <iostream.h>
int main()
{
int nilai;
//memasukkan bilangan bulat
cout<<”Masukkan sebuah bilangan yang akan diperiksa: “;
cin>>nilai;
//pengecek bilangan apakah habis dibagi dua atau tidak
if (nilai > 0)
{
cout<<nilai<<“ adalah bilangan positif“;
}
else if (nilai < 0)
{
cout<<nilai<<“ adalah bilangan negatif“;
}
else
{
cout<<“Anda memasukkan bilangan NOL“;
}
return 0;
}

*=============================================================

Kegunaan “Switch-case”

*=============================================================

#include <iostream.h>
int main()
{
int bil;
cout<<”Masukkan sebuah angka untuk hadiah anda

:P (1 sampai 7):”;
cin>>bil;
switch (bil)
{
case 1:
cout<<”Hadiah anda ke-”<<bil<<”adalah Notebook Acer tanpa proccesor”;
break;
case 2:
cout<<”Hadiah anda ke-”<<bil<<” adalah Personal Computer tanpa motherboard”;
break;
case 3:
cout<<”Hadiah anda ke”<<bil<<”adalah Cewek stensilan”;
break;
case 4:
cout<<”Hadiah anda ke-”<<bil<<”adalah Anda belum beruntung”;
break;
case 5:
cout<<”Hadiah anda ke-”<<bil<<”adalah Voucer berenang gratis di sungai Amazon”;
break;
case 6:
cout<<”Hadiah anda ke-”<<bil<<”adalah Silahkan lihat cermin dan berdoalah”;
break;
case 7:
cout<<”Hadiah anda ke-”<<bil<<”adalah Love your Passion”;
break;
}
return 0;
}

*=============================================================

Enjoy this Post!

Add to Mixx!

Random Posts




Leave a Reply